Project Overview

The Sacheon HyperCloud Data Campus is a 300MW AI-ready hyperscale campus in southern Korea, developed by PDI Design Group (U.S.) and PDI Korea Lab. The project is supported by a U.S.-based lead investor, major Korean commercial banks, and designated as a national Opportunity Zone.

Built on 150,650㎡, HCDC provides scalable power (345kV dual-grid), hybrid liquid-air cooling (PUE 1.25), and Tier-1 construction execution for reliability.

Connectivity & MMR

Sacheon Campus is strategically positioned on major Asia-Pacific subsea cable routes, providing global connectivity.

Busan-Geoje-Sacheon subsea cable connections enable low-latency access to major financial and technology centers including Tokyo, Hong Kong, and Singapore.
